Casa Delfino Hotel & Spa - Chania (Crete)
35.517047, 24.015758Overview
Featuring a wellness area along with a Turkish steam bath and a Turkish steam room, the 5-star Casa Delfino Hotel & Spa is situated just a 9-minute walk from Firkas Fortress, one of the historical sites in Chania. The hotel also provides guests with a safety deposit box and 24-hour security.
Location
The accommodation is located just 5 minutes' walk from Mosque of Kioutsouk Hassan, at a medium distance from Municipal Art Gallery of Chania. At the Casa Delfino Hotel & Spa Chania you'll be around a 5-minute walk from Aegean Sea. Nature lovers will appreciate the proximity to Nea Chora beach, which is around 25 minutes' walk away. Casa Delfino Hotel & Spa is situated a few minutes' drive from Eleftherios Venizelos Museum of Chalepa, and KTEL Station Terminal of Chania bus station lies about a 10-minute walk away.
For those travelling from afar, Souda airport is 18 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
There are 25 rooms with an adjoining terrace and a balcony. Some of them offer a TV with satellite channels, along with tea/coffee making equipment. The nice touches include sound-proofed windows, along with a sofa and a work desk. Guests can also enjoy views of the sea.

missingWrote a review on 12 Augcharming locationfriendly staffroom spacebathroom size
Casa Delfino charmed me completely. The location in Old Town made it easy to explore the area's shops and restaurants. I loved the included breakfast. Fresh pastries, homemade treats, and delicious coffee every morning in a pretty courtyard set the tone for the day. The staff were friendly and genuinely eager to help with anything I needed. They arranged dinner reservations and offered fantastic recommendations. The rooftop bar served fine views of the harbor, perfect for evening relaxation. My room was a bit cramped, particularly the bathroom. It felt tight with the family of four. The steep stairs to the first room were a concern for safety, especially at night. Shifting to one level was necessary for comfort. Despite these issues, the comfort of the bed and the overall décor still won me over. I'd recommend careful room selection if traveling with mobility issues. While it felt pricey, the ambiance and really good service made it worthwhile.
